Output 8586fdf9d483db80c72981d1b9582dad672745912113a1abe84c5e6b9bc1511f:21

value
7100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0303a2e660ee0460833c84b7fe9013f3432310e0 OP_EQUAL
address
9riD3d1hwXWTjDEKMZbQuG2bdNcFTCkepd
transaction
8586fdf9d483db80c72981d1b9582dad672745912113a1abe84c5e6b9bc1511f